Content Themes
The podcast focuses on themes such as black maternal health, wellness practices, and cultural heritage with specific episodes highlighting Black Maternal Health Week and discussions on the importance of doulas and maternal support systems. Future episodes may also explore holistic health practices and spiritual success within communities.
